The librarians here are very helpful and they have a good selection in kids and adults books for such a small library. They have a comfortable place to curl up and read with your children as well as study tables. The story time is fun. There is plenty of free parking on the street, unlike the Main branch downtown. This library also participates in the«Food for Fines» program during the holiday season from Nov– Dec. This is a great way to help feed the hungry in our community. My kids like to shop with me as we pick out food to donate and they learn to give to others in our community and also be thankful for what they have. My only complaint is that this is the branch that has had its hours cut a lot. We used to go to this library a lot more.
